Fear is a normal human emotional reaction which occurs whenever we sense an actual danger signal or are confronted with something unknown which we perceive to be dangerous. A degree of fear is natural and can keep us safe from harm.

Anxiety is similar to fear but usually occurs as a result of anticipation of what might happen in the future rather than a real threat, for instance performance anxiety, or anxiety about a forthcoming exam or making a speech. More extreme cases of anxiety can develop into anxiety disorders or panic attacks.

A Phobia is a fear or anxiety which is so intense that it can adversely affect a person's life as they seek to avoid any situation where they might be confronted with the feared object or situation and make unrealistic interpretations about the potential danger. In cases of severe anxiety and phobias, the response to the stimulus is automatic and happens at a subconscious level so cannot be consciously controlled.

Most phobias are 'learnt' behaviours, usually either 'passed on' from parents or significant adults in our lives (sometimes subconsciously), or are the result of a distressing experience which has created an 'anchor' or 'trigger' to the stimulus.
